CSS(Cascading Style Sheets)는 웹 페이지를 디자인하고 레이아웃하는 데 사용되는 기술 언어로 웹 페이지의 스타일, 글꼴, 색상 및 기타 측면을 제어할 수 있습니다. 웹 디자인의 발전과 함께 웹 디자인 프로세스를 단순화하고 개발자가 아름답고 강력한 웹 사이트를 더 빠르게 만들 수 있도록 설계된 다양한 CSS 프레임워크가 등장했습니다. 그러나 동시에 CSS 프레임워크에 대한 무단 액세스가 걱정스러운 문제가 되었습니다. 이 기사에서는 CSS 프레임워크에 대한 무단 액세스의 위험성과 대책을 살펴보겠습니다.
우선 CSS 프레임워크 무단 액세스가 무엇을 의미하는지 이해해야 합니다. 간단히 말하면, 악의적인 사용자가 CSS 프레임워크의 코드를 수정하여 웹사이트에 무단으로 액세스하는 것을 의미합니다. 이러한 무단 접근으로 인해 다음과 같은 피해가 발생할 수 있습니다.
첫째, 데이터 유출 위험입니다. 악의적인 사용자가 CSS 프레임워크에 액세스하면 웹 사이트의 스타일 시트를 변조하여 사용자 계정 및 비밀번호와 같은 민감한 정보를 얻을 수 있습니다. 이는 이용자에게 심각한 위협이며, 개인정보 유출 및 계정 도용으로 이어질 수 있습니다.
둘째, 웹사이트 변조 위험. CSS 프레임워크는 웹사이트의 전체 스타일과 레이아웃을 제어합니다. 승인 없이 액세스하면 악의적인 사용자가 이러한 스타일과 레이아웃을 수정하여 웹사이트를 변조할 수 있습니다. 여기에는 사용자를 오도하고 혼란스럽게 하기 위해 웹사이트의 콘텐츠, 링크, 탐색 기능을 조작하는 행위가 포함될 수 있습니다.
셋째, 악성코드 삽입의 위험성입니다. 악의적인 사용자는 CSS 프레임워크에 대한 무단 액세스를 통해 웹 사이트에 악성 코드를 삽입할 수 있습니다. 이러한 악성코드에는 광고 팝업, 악성 링크, 악성 스크립트 등이 포함될 수 있으며, 이는 사용자 컴퓨터에 보안 위험을 가져오고 심지어 조작이나 바이러스 감염으로 이어질 수도 있습니다.
그렇다면 CSS 프레임워크에 대한 무단 액세스 위협에 어떻게 대처해야 할까요? 다음은 몇 가지 효과적인 대처 전략입니다.
먼저 업데이트하고 유지관리하세요. CSS 프레임워크를 적시에 업데이트하고 유지하는 것은 무단 액세스를 방지하는 중요한 조치 중 하나입니다. 개발자는 정기적으로 프레임워크에 보안 취약점이 있는지 확인하고 패치와 업데이트를 즉시 적용해야 합니다. 또한, 웹사이트의 스타일 시트를 정기적으로 검토하고 정리하여 무단 수정이 없는지 확인해야 합니다.
둘째, 접근을 제한하세요. 무단 액세스를 방지하려면 개발자는 CSS 프레임워크 파일에 대한 액세스를 제한해야 합니다. 승인된 사용자 또는 사용자 그룹만 이러한 파일에 액세스하고 수정할 수 있습니다. 예를 들어 파일 권한을 설정하고 액세스 제어 목록을 사용하여 이를 수행할 수 있습니다.
셋째, 입력 유효성 검사 및 필터링입니다. 개발자는 악성 코드 삽입을 방지하기 위해 사용자가 입력한 데이터를 검증하고 필터링해야 합니다. 이는 WAF(웹 애플리케이션 방화벽) 및 정규식과 같은 입력 유효성 검사 도구 및 필터를 사용하여 달성할 수 있습니다.
넷째, 모니터링과 로깅입니다. 개발자는 CSS 프레임워크에 대한 무단 액세스를 즉시 감지하고 수정하기 위해 효과적인 모니터링 및 로깅 메커니즘을 확립해야 합니다. 이는 로그 관리 시스템과 보안 이벤트 모니터링 도구를 통해 수행할 수 있습니다.
결론적으로 CSS 프레임워크 무단 액세스는 데이터 유출, 웹사이트 변조, 악성 코드 주입 등의 위험으로 이어질 수 있는 심각한 보안 위협입니다. 이러한 위협에 대처하기 위해 개발자는 CSS 프레임워크를 즉시 업데이트 및 유지 관리하고, 액세스 권한을 제한하고, 사용자 입력을 검증 및 필터링하고, 효과적인 모니터링 및 로깅 메커니즘을 설정해야 합니다. 이러한 대응 전략을 통해서만 웹사이트의 보안을 보장하고 좋은 사용자 경험을 제공할 수 있습니다.
위 내용은 CSS 프레임워크의 무단 액세스에 대한 위험 및 대책의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!